Why: By contracting for cheap tomatoes grown and picked by farmworkers paid sub-poverty wages in Florida, Taco Bell contributes significantly to the continued misery of farmworkers and their families. Taco Bell tomato pickers are still earning the same wages they earned twenty years ago, and the median income of farmworkers in Florida, where Taco Bell's tomatoes are harvested, is only $7,500. Taco Bell tomato pickers are only asking for a one cent per pound raise. The large corporations that buy Florida tomatoes must step up to their responsibility by demanding, and obtaining, changes in the shameful pay and working conditions suffered by the men and women who pick their tomatoes.
